Organizing mail

You can organize messages in any mailbox, folder, or search results window. You can delete or mark
messages as read. You can also move messages from one mailbox or folder to another in the same
account or between different accounts. You can add, delete, or rename mailboxes and folders.
Delete a message: Open the message and tap .
You can also delete a message directly from the mailbox message list by swiping left or right over
the message title, then tapping Delete.

Some mail accounts support archiving messages instead of deleting them. When you archive
a message, it’s moved from your Inbox to All Mail. Turn archiving on or off in Settings > Mail,
Contacts, Calendars.

Recover a message

Deleted messages are moved to the Trash mailbox.
To change how long a message stays in the Trash before being deleted
permanently, go to Settings > Mail, Contacts, Calendars. Then tap Advanced.

Delete or move multiple messages

While viewing a list of messages, tap Edit, select the messages you want to
delete, then tap Move or Delete.

Move a message to another
mailbox or folder

While viewing a message, tap , then choose a mailbox or folder.

Add a mailbox

Go to the mailboxes list, tap Edit, then tap New Mailbox.

Delete or rename a mailbox

Go to the mailboxes list, tap Edit, then tap a mailbox. Enter a new name or
location for the mailbox. Tap Delete Mailbox to delete it and all its contents.

Flag and mark multiple messages
as read

While viewing a list of messages, tap Edit, select the messages you want,
then tap Mark. Choose either Flag or Mark as Read.
